WebColin Purdie Kelly Jr. (/ ˈ k oʊ l ɪ n / KOHL-in; July 11, 1915 – December 10, 1941) was a World War II B-17 Flying Fortress pilot who flew bombing runs against the Japanese navy in the first days after the Pearl Harbor attack.He is remembered as one of the first American heroes of the war after ordering his crew to bail out while he remained at the bomber's … WebFeb 4, 2016 · Coincidentally, the B-17E was assigned to the Kangaroo Squadron, which flew into Pearl Harbor from San Francisco during the Japanese attack on December 7, 1941. This occurrence contributed to the disaster because U.S. radar personnel on Hawaii assumed the incoming Japanese attack wave represented the squadron’s expected arrival.

WebNov 1, 2024 · The objective of the strikes at Pearl Harbor and the Philippines was to shield Japan’s drive southward to seize the oil and natural resources of Southeast Asia and the Dutch East Indies. The strategy was to clear the US forces in the Philippines out of the way. Key targets were the fighter bases.
